Alcoa says thankyou to Timehelp volunteers

Timehelp is a volunteer support group for retired people working with Western Sydney primary and high schools. Timehelp volunteers recently spent the afternoon at Yennora learning about Alcoa’s business and enjoying an afternoon tea.

The Alcoa Foundation provides vital funding for this group. Originally Alcoa helped set up Timehelp with the idea of finding volunteer opportunities for retired staff. Timehelp now has 25 dedicated people working with Holroyd Council where they do an amazing job helping out in the local schools in this area.
 
Alcoa Yennora recently hosted the Timehelp Western Sydney group to the site taking them on a site tour and giving them an update on our recycling operation. 
 
In his speech, Thegie Moodley said “your work in our local community is greatly appreciated, Alcoa Yennora has been a part of the local landscape for over 30 years as an employer and supporter of the community in which it operates. We’d like to take this site to the next level in developing our recycling operation and being an innovator in can recycling and bringing to reality the 100% recycled can.”
